DB Index Research -- Weekly ETF Market Review -- Asia-Pacific

March 11, 2010--Highlights
Market Overview
There are 205 equity based ETFs in the Asia Pacific region with 281 listings across 12 countries and 15 exchanges. Japan has the largest market share by AUM accounting for 41.06% of the whole market, whilst China has the largest market share by turnover with 37.41%.

There was one new listing in the last week. Deutsche Bank AG listed one new ETF on Singapore Stock Exchange. The listing was cross listing.

Turnover Monthly average daily turnover declined 7.7% in the last week. Turnover for the previous week was USD 744m. The largest ETF by turnover was the China 50 ETF issued by China Asset Management with USD 159m accounting for 21.4% of total turnover.

Assets Under Management
AUM rose 1.6% in the previous week. AUM as of March 8th were USD 59.8bn.
The largest ETF by AUM is the TOPIX ETF managed by Nomura Asset Management with AUM of USD 6.2bn.

- Overseas Investor Participation in HKEx's Securities Market Remains High

March 11, 2010--Overseas investor participation in the securities market of Hong Kong Exchanges and Clearing Limited (HKEx) remained high despite the market downturn during the global financial crisis, according to HKEx's Cash Market Transaction Survey 2008/09 (covering HKEx's securities market turnover from October 2008 to September 2009).

The survey found that the contribution of overseas investors to total market turnover value remained at a relatively high level of more than 40 per cent for the fourth consecutive year (42 per cent in 2008/09, compared to 41 per cent in 2007/08) while local investors' contribution fell to a record low of 50 per cent. The contribution of institutional investors decreased somewhat from its peak of 65 per cent in 2006/07 and 2007/08 to 62 per cent in 2008/09. The contribution of retail investors was 30 per cent, similar to the all-time low of 29 per cent in 2007/08.

Some other key findings of the 2008/09 survey

Overseas institutional investors, the largest contributors among all investor types, contributed 38 per cent to total market turnover, similar to the level in 2007/08.

Local retail investors' contribution to total market turnover was a record low of 25 per cent in 2008/09, compared to 26 per cent in 2007/08. (Figure 1)

India aims to be world's fastest growing economy

March 11, 2010--Just how fast can India grow? Ask Manal Farooq, who can't make gloves quickly enough.

"We are facing a major problem," said Farooq, a senior executive at Marvel Gloves Industries, which produces 3 million pairs of gloves a month, most used in industrial production in India. "Despite importing gloves we are not able to meet demand."

The run on gloves began five months ago, said Farooq, whose customers include Ford and Nissan.

It's been driven by a record rebound in manufacturing, spurred in part by government stimulus, which has led India out of the Great Recession faster than many imagined possible.

Singapore Exchange To Offer Nifty Options, Related Products

March 10, 2010--The Singapore Exchange (SGX) has announced that it expects to offer options on the S&P CNX Nifty Index (Nifty) and related products in the coming year.

This follows SGX’s obtaining of licensing rights from India Index Services & Products Limited (IISL) for the product range including derivative contracts on the CNX Nifty Junior, CNX 100 and CNX Midcap indices. The addition of these products is subject to relevant regulatory approvals. The new India-based products aim to provide market participants with increased trading opportunities and enhanced means for risk management.

National Stock Exchange Of India And Singapore Exchange To Explore Listing More India-Linked Products On SGX

March 10, 2010--National Stock Exchange of India Limited (NSE) and Singapore Exchange (SGX) have sign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MOU) to cooperate in the development of a market for India-linked products.

Under the MOU, both exchanges aim to explore future collaboration in the expansion, development and promotion of India-linked products and services to be listed on SGX.

Subject to regulatory approval, these products may include equity products and other asset classes. The two exchanges also will look into a bilateral securities trading link to enable investors in one country to seamlessly trade on the other country’s exchange.

14 Foreign Commodity ETFs to be Listed (ETF Securities Limited)

March 9, 2010--The Tokyo Stock Exchange (TSE) approved today the listing of 14 foreign commodity ETFs. These foreign ETFs are managed by ETF Securities Limited and their main market is the London Stock Exchange. The 14 ETFs are scheduled to be listed on Friday, March 19, 2010.

Shanghai exchange completes draft rules for global board

March 8, 2010--The Shanghai Stock Exchange (SSE) has completed draft rules governing the listing and trading of overseas-based companies, chairman Geng Liang said yesterday, as China moves closer to the international board launch.

The new so-called international board would allow foreign-domiciled companies to make initial public offerings in China.

The draft rules are subject to change and public opinion will be sought in due course, but there's no official timetable for the launch of the new board, Geng told a news briefing on the sidelines of the National People's Congress in Beijing.

China’s Foreign ETF Plan Signals Market Reform, West China Says

March 8, 2010--China’s plan to introduce exchange- traded funds that track overseas stock indexes signals a push to create more opportunities for investors as the market matures, according to West China Securities Co.

The Shanghai Stock Exchange will try to introduce exchange- traded funds that track foreign indexes this year, Chairman Geng Liang said at a briefing in Beijing yesterday, without disclosing the indexes.

“This is the way China is gradually relaxing control over overseas investment and the first destination for overseas ETF funds will probably be the Hong Kong market, because of familiarity,” said Wei Wei, an analyst at West China Securities in Shanghai. “Investors will have more options to invest overseas.”

China cautions against expecting fast yuan rise

March 8, 2010--Any rise in the yuan’s exchange rate will be gradual, China’s trade chief said on Monday in comments that underline the competing interests at the heart of Chinese policy-making.

Commerce Minister Chen Deming said a halt to the yuan’s appreciation since mid-2008 was part of a panoply of pro-growth policies to prop up the economy during the global credit crunch.

China has effectively re-pegged its exchange rate at around 6.83 yuan per dollar since mid-2008 to help its exporters during the global financial crisis and is under intense pressure from the United States and Europe to abandon the peg.
